The
St. Louis Arc was founded in 1950 by a group of activist parents
who wanted more for their children with mental retardation. It has
a long tradition of advocacy and respect for the rights of people
with developmental disabilities—from its earliest work in opening
education and recreation opportunities to today’s commitment to
high-quality, person-centered programs and services. For the past 55
years, the St. Louis Arc has offered a wide array of
services, including residential, employment, leisure, respite,
family support, early intervention, prevention and advocacy.
